(3-AMINO-1-BENZOFURAN-2-YL)(4-CHLOROPHENYL)METHANONE is a chemical compound with an aromatic structure, consisting of a benzofuran ring fused with an amino group and a phenyl ring substituted with a chlorine atom, connected to a methanone functional group. Its unique structure endows it with the potential to exhibit various pharmacological activities, including interactions with biological receptors and enzymes.

Check Digit Verification of cas no

The CAS Registry Mumber 70344-79-5 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,0,3,4 and 4 respectively; the second part has 2 digits, 7 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 70344-79:
(7*7)+(6*0)+(5*3)+(4*4)+(3*4)+(2*7)+(1*9)=115
115 % 10 = 5
So 70344-79-5 is a valid CAS Registry Number.

Synthesis and evaluation of some novel essential amino acid-benzofuran-acetamide/propanamide/butanamide hybrids as potential anticonvulsant agents

Kamal, Mehnaz

, p. 283 - 289 (2020/09/18)

In this study, some new essential amino acid-benzofuran-acetamide/propanamide/butanamide hybrid derivatives were synthesized. The structures of the synthesized compounds were confirmed on the basis of their elemental and spectral analyses. Their anti-seizure activity was investigated using maximal electroshock seizure (MES) and subcutaneous metrazol (scMET) seizure tests in mice. Neurotoxicity (NT) of the synthesized compounds was also determined by the rotarod test. Derivatives exhibited favorable protection in both MES and scMET tests with high safety levels in NT test. The derivatives have proven significant activity in mice and could be suggested as potential anticonvulsant lead compounds. All leucine-chlorobenzoyl benzofuran-acetamide/propanamide/ butanamide hybrid derivatives (6b, 7b, and 8b) showed significant anticonvulsant activity in MES model. Compound 8b also demonstrated potent anticonvulsant activity against scMET test. The compound 8b showed maximum activity and would be considered as a lead for further optimization as anticonvulsant agent.
